
The 121 dockets and the disbandment of the political killings task team took centre stage at the Madlanga Commission on Monday. New witness, General Mary Motsepe testified that the dockets were brought to the head office in Pretoria for auditing purposes. However, testimony before the Madlanga Commission demonstrates that only 92 of those dockets were audited. Additionally, the SAPS head office missed two additional dockets, which were part of the bundle that was seized from the KwaZulu-Natal political killings task team.
